As ABC airs The Conners,’ Roseanne Barr plans to move to Israel for a little while.
While on Rabbi Shmuley Boteach’s podcast, she said:
I have an opportunity to go to Israel for a few months and study with my favorite teacher over there, and that’s where I’m going to go and probably move somewhere there and study with my favorite teachers.
I have saved a few pennies and I’m so lucky I can go.
“I’m staying away from it,” said Barr about The Conners going on without her. “Not wishing bad on anyone and I don’t wish good for my enemies,” said Barr.
In the podcast she called Donald Trump a “friend,” and that “he has done some great things-some things he needs to fix up a little and I am available to tell him what that is.”
